Scope

This course aims to introduce the students to practical training in various departments in the industry to enhance practical skills and provide hands-on experience in a real-world scenario. The training facilitates students to find out problems related to pharmaceutical product development. This course also equips the student with first-hand training in a professional environment and prepares students for employability in a pharmaceutical environment. Students are exposed to working conditions of control environments requiring regulatory approval of pharmaceutical products and professional interactions. Aligning academic knowledge with industry expectations facilitates professional connections and networking opportunities. While exposed to different challenges in the pharmaceutical industry, the communication skills, leadership and critical thinking abilities of students are enhanced.

This course train the students to gain insight into pharmaceutical industrial trends, technology and practice. Overall this practical training aims to expose the students in various departments of pharma industry especially in manufacturing, quality control quality assurance, research and development.

Objectives and Outcomes

Upon successful completion of the course, the student shall be able to,

KNOWLEDGE :

(K1) Discuss the layout of various departments in pharmaceutical industry.

(K2 ) Describe the operations and conditions employed in various manufacturing, quality control or research departments/ premises.

(K3) Explain the maintenance of documents and records in different departments of industry.

(K4) Analyse the warehousing, material supply and handling.

(K5) Differentiate packaging and labelling requirements of different pharmaceutical products.

(K6) Assess the regulatory requirements of pharmaceuticals.

SKILL

(S1) Develop SOP for pharmaceutical processes and equipments. (S2) Gain experience in equipment handling and documentation. (S3) Identify a process problem in the pharmaceutical industry. (S4) Evaluate the literature based on the problem.

(S5) Design the process improvement work plan.

(S6) Prepare the report of activities completed and the proposal.

ATTITUDE

(A1) Develop interpersonal skills in a pharmaceutical environment.

(A2) Communicate effectively with the people in the pharmaceutical companies. (A3) Adapt to different working environments in different departments.

(A4) Embrace problem-solving skills. (A5) Cultivate time management quality.

(A6) Appreciate the team and resource management.

Evaluation Pattern

Evaluation:

The assessment is done by the academic guide and industrial mentor. There will be continuous evaluation by the industrial mentor on day to day activities. The students shall submit the report of industrial internship activities at the end of the internship. The report shall include the activities and outcomes ( that may include title of future project, aim,

objectives and proposed work plan). The report and presentation will be evaluated by a department-level committee.
